[Libreoffice-bugs] [Bug 116674] New: Link table styles to paragraph style
https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/show_bug.cgi?id=116674 Bug ID: 116674 Summary: Link table styles to paragraph style Product: LibreOffice Version: unspecified Hardware: All OS: All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: major Priority: high Component: Writer Assignee: libreoffice-bugs@lists.freedesktop.org Reporter: tietze.he...@gmail.com CC: rayk...@gmail.com Blocks: 107553 Tables are added with the default table style, which is Serif/12 since 6.0 (bug 101349, bug 107554, bug 107555). If the paragraph has different settings, let's say handwriting style, the table doesn't take this style regardless what is set in the paragraph style Table Contents. Even worse, every time the table is modified (add/delete row/col) it's style is reapplied making any direct formatting pointless. The only workaround is to modify the table style itself, which is only possible via the legacy feature of autoformatting. Unchecking font in the legacy autoformat dialog is overridden on changes to the table. Two possible solutions come in mind: do not set font, alignment, pattern in the default table style (blocked by the missing XML serialization yet bug 49437) or link font to what is set under paragraph styles (error-prone as users can delete Table Content there or have different styles). And finally if the user applied direct formatting it must not reverted on any modifications to the table (likely a result of bug 115573). [Libreoffice-bugs] [Bug 116676] New: Function insertTextPortion() of XTextPortionAppend Interface doesn't work
https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/show_bug.cgi?id=116676 Bug ID: 116676 Summary: Function insertTextPortion() of XTextPortionAppend Interface doesn't work Product: LibreOffice Version: 5.4.6.2 release Hardware: x86-64 (AMD64) OS: All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: normal Priority: medium Component: BASIC Assignee: libreoffice-bugs@lists.freedesktop.org Reporter: rolan...@free.fr Created attachment 140932 --> https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/attachment.cgi?id=140932=edit Simple document with a form that contains a rich text control The function insertTextPortion() of the XTextPortionAppend Interface doesn't work. I attached a simple document that contains a form with a rich text control. The following macro should first insert the unformatted text "Text", then append the formatted text "Append" (in Arial red) using apendTextPortion() and at last insert at the beginning the text "Insert" (in Arial red) using insertTextPortion(). While appendTextPortion() works as expected (text is appended with the right format), insertTextPortion() does not work: simply, nothing happens when it is called. Here is the test macro: Sub Test() Dim oForm As Object, oCtrl as Object ' Get form and rich text control oForm = thisComponent.DrawPage.Forms.getByName("Form1") oCtrl = oForm.getByName("Text1") ' Append unformatted text => works oCtrl.Text = "Text" ' Text properties Dim aStyleProps(1) As New com.sun.star.beans.PropertyValue aStyleProps(0).Name = "CharColor" aStyleProps(0).Value = rgb( 255, 0, 0 ) aStyleProps(1).Name = "CharFontName" aStyleProps(1).Value = "Arial" ' Append formatted text => works oCtrl.appendTextPortion("Append", aStyleProps) ' Insert formatted text at the start => does not work Dim oTextCursor as Object oTextCursor = oCtrl.createTextCursor() oTextCursor.GotoStart(FALSE) oCtrl.insertTextPortion("Insert", aStyleProps, oTextCursor) End Sub -- You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ug.___ Libreoffice-bugs mailing list Libreoffice-bugs@lists.freedesktop.org https://lists.freedesktop.org/mailman/listinfo/libreoffice-bugs

[Libreoffice-bugs] [Bug 116678] New: [FORMATTING, FILESAVE, FILEOPEN] TEXT function format code argument is not properly translated
https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/show_bug.cgi?id=116678 Bug ID: 116678 Summary: [FORMATTING,FILESAVE,FILEOPEN] TEXT function format code argument is not properly translated Product: LibreOffice Version: 5.4.5.1 release Hardware: x86-64 (AMD64) OS: Linux (All)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: normal Priority: medium Component: Calc Assignee: libreoffice-bugs@lists.freedesktop.org Reporter: g.deth...@gmail.com Description: In LibreOffice Calc 5.4.5.1 with locale fr-BE, when editing an XLS file, the formula for formatting a date in a cell with TEXT function must be written TEXTE(DATE(2018;3;28);"mm") when function name translation is not disabled (which is the default). The equivalent English formula is TEXT(DATE(2018,3,28),"mm"). However, when saving this to a file and reading it with Apache POI library (https://poi.apache.org/), the persisted formula is TEXT(DATE(2018,3,28),"mm") which is OK except for the format string that has not been translated into "mm". Using directly the English format code ("mm") prevents the date to be properly formatted in LibreOffice but leads to the persistence of the right formula in the file. I would expect that: 1. TEXTE(DATE(2018;3;28);"mm") (or whatever internationalized equivalent) is properly persisted as TEXT(DATE(2018;3;28);"mm") 2. Disabling function name translation also disables format code translation (i.e. "mm" becomes a valid format code) Note that a possible workaround is to change the locale of LibreOffice to English via Menu > Options > Language Settings.
